Israeli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u addressed the people of Iran in a video message on Monday, saying the Shia nation would very soon be freed from the “rule of tyrants.”

In a three-minute video clip released by his office, Netanyahu said Israel stands with the people of Iran.

Netanyahu said, “Every day, you see a regime that takes you over, making fiery speeches about protecting Lebanon, protecting Gaza. Yet every day, that regime drags our region into darkness. And plunges deeper into the war.”

“The dictators of Iran don’t care about your future, but you do. When Iran is finally free, and that moment will come much sooner than people think, everything will be different. Our two ancient peoples, the Jewish people and the Persian people, There will be peace eventually,” he said.

“There is no place we will not go to protect our people and to protect our country,” Netanyahu said.

He said, “I know you do not support the rapists and murderers of Hamas and Hezbollah, but your leaders do. You deserve more. The people of Iran should know that Israel stands with you.”

Nasrallah’s assassination was one of the most serious blows to both Hezbollah and Iran in decades. He was the most powerful leader in Iran’s ‘axis of resistance’ against Israel and US interests in the Middle East.

Israel indicated on Monday that a ground invasion into Lebanon was an option after two weeks of intense airstrikes and the ouster of Nasrallah, as the group’s deputy leader said it was prepared for any attack.
